Score 96/100 · Drink 2020-2040, Monica Larner, Wine Advocate, May 2019

There is a gorgeous nuttiness to the 2015 Paleo. It is a highly aromatic expression of Cabernet Franc, with a bouquet of roses and some notes of red cherry. The vineyard team was careful in timing the harvest and fermentations to make sure the fruit did not come in too ripe and so they could maintain the natural freshness of the grapes. The oak used is moderately to highly toasted so they could get more of those nutty notes instead of the more common coffee or chocolate aromas we associate with barrique. It is aged for 22 months and the overall result is incredible.

Score 95/100 · Drink 2022-2035, Antonio Galloni, Vinous, Mar 2019

The 2015 Paleo Rosso is powerful, dense and super-concentrated, with all of the richness of the vintage very much on display. The 2015 is going to need time in bottle to develop the full breadth of its aromatics. Today, it is dense, powerful and very closed. Even so, there is terrific persistence and follow through. All the 2015 needs is time to unwind.

Score 17.5/20 · Drink 2019-2028, Walter Speller, jancisrobinson.com, Feb 2019

100% Cabernet Franc. Around 20 – 25 days on the skins and aged for 14 months in barrique (70% new) followed by 18 months in bottle. 'We are always a year later than everyone else because we want to have at least a year in bottle. The wine is expensive and we want to honour our clients.' Deep crimson. Complex oak notes over a rich layer of dark fruit. Intense forest fruit palate with a salty minerally note on the finish and with long, grainy tannins. Ready now, but much more to come. (WS)
